Explorer of the Seas Stateroom: Features, Layout, and Cabin Reviews

Explorer of the Seas offers a variety of stateroom options with 1,641 total accommodations. This includes 115 luxury suites, 652 balcony rooms, 232 ocean view rooms, 138 promenade view rooms, and 504 interior cabins, with 81 featuring virtual balconies. Cheapest Places to Live in Mass: A Guide to Affordable Living in Massachusetts

The cheapest places to live in Massachusetts are Springfield, Pittsfield, Chicopee, and Gardner. Worcester County and Hampden County provide affordable options, especially near highways. In 2025, Springfield stands out with a median home price of $300,000. Explore these cities for budget-friendly living. Other affordable towns include Fitchburg and Greenfield.
